Key Factors to Consider When Buying a Mobility Scooter
Type of Scooter
3-Wheel Scooters: Ideal for indoor usage and tight areas. They are more maneuverable but may offer less stability on irregular terrain.4-Wheel Scooters: Better fit for outside usage and rougher surface. They offer more stability and can support much heavier weights.
Range and Speed
Range: Consider how far you require to travel. Some scooters can increase to 30 miles on a single charge, while others might have a much shorter variety.Speed: Most mobility scooters have an optimal speed of 4-8 miles per hour, however this can vary based on the design and your specific needs.
Weight Capacity
Ensure the scooter can support your weight. Models typically range from 250 to 500 pounds.
Portability
If you prepare to transport your scooter regularly, try to find models that are lightweight and can be easily dismantled. Some scooters even suit the trunk of a vehicle.
Security Features
Brakes: Look for scooters with reputable braking systems.Lights: Rear and front lights can improve presence, particularly crucial if you prepare to utilize the scooter at night or in low-light conditions.Seat: Ergonomic seats with adjustable functions can significantly improve comfort and assistance.
Warranty and Customer Support

Q: How do I choose the right size and kind of mobility scooter?
A: Consider your main usage (indoor or outside), weight, and the kind of terrain you will be navigating. 3-wheel scooters are better for indoor use, while 4-wheel scooters are preferable for outdoor experiences.
Q: Are mobility scooters simple to use?
A: Yes, many mobility scooters are designed with easy to use controls and are simple to run. Many designs include training manuals and can be tailored to match your particular requirements.
Q: How much do mobility scooters cost?
A: Prices can vary widely depending upon the design and features. Entry-level scooters can cost around ₤ 500, while high-end designs with innovative features can be priced over ₤ 3,000.
Q: Can I get a mobility scooter through insurance coverage?
A: Some insurance strategies, including Medicare, might cover the cost of a mobility scooter under particular conditions. Contact your insurance company to see if you qualify.
Q: What upkeep does a mobility scooter require?
A: Regular maintenance consists of checking the battery, tires, and brakes. It's also essential to keep the scooter clean and dry. Follow the manufacturer's guidelines for specific upkeep tasks.
Q: Are there any legal requirements for utilizing a mobility scooter?
